Transponder Chip Keys The majority of cars built in the last 20 years are equipped with a key that has a transponder. This is a great security feature that makes it much more difficult for thieves to wire your car and then start it. This does not make them impossible however, since they've found new ways to make it difficult for them to get in with the extra layer of security. A key that has transponder chips has an electronic microchip inside it that communicates with car's computer system on board when the key is inserted into the ignition lock cylinder. It then can start the engine and deactivate the car's standard immobilizer system. The chip also has information about who the owner is to ensure that it cannot be used by anyone who is not the owner of the vehicle to start it. Keyless Start Vehicles Many modern Suzuki cars use keys that look like some sort of remote control and comes with advanced security features. These keys have a transponder inside that needs to be programmed before starting the vehicle. These keys will require a visit to the dealer or a professional locksmith who has the correct equipment for key programming to work on them. This kind of key also incorporates a LF field in order to determine if a person is inside or outside the vehicle when the key is press. This is to ensure that the vehicle can't be started when someone is trying to alter it at a gas station for example. The LF fields have to be strong enough to be read however, it is recommended to allow for an overshoots to allow the signal to penetrate into things such as windows.
